The Legacy at North Augusta, Inc.
The Legacy at North Augusta, Inc. is a senior living community in Staunton, Virginia, offering independent living, assisted living, memory care, and respite care, along with specialized services for hospice care and veterans assistance. With 135 licensed beds, it is a larger community that can serve older adults at different levels of need and is currently operating at approximately a 71% occupancy rate.
Across 17 total inspections, 14 resulted in violations, which is higher than the Virginia average of 64.3%. The cumulative deficiency count is also at 33, which is near the state average of 32. The most recent inspection on September 23, 2025, cited medication administration issues among other violations. Recurring themes also include medication administration errors, individualized service plan documentation, resident record security, and hazardous material storage. Complaint investigations were mostly unsubstantiated, with two substantiated complaints involving staffing levels on the secured memory care unit and building conditions. However, no immediate jeopardy findings, license suspensions, or fines were reported.
Clinical services include nursing services, licensed nurses and CNAs, 24-hour staffing, rehabilitation services, and respite care. Restaurant-style dining is provided, and the community’s programming spans lifestyle amenities, therapy services, and memory care support. The Veterans Assistance program is also a relevant differentiator for families with a military service background.
The Legacy at North Augusta is a great option for older adults and families seeking a larger community that offers full continuum care, veterans support, and diverse living options. However, families are encouraged to discuss the community’s medication management protocols and recent corrective actions directly with administration before making a placement decision, as regulatory records warrant close attention on such matters.

Inspection Reports Summary
An editor-reviewed summary of the themes and findings across this facility's recent inspection reports.
- The most recent inspection on September 23, 2025, found one deficiency for medication administration timing errors with Hydrocodone-acetaminophen doses.
- Renewal inspections in November 2024 and September 2025 cited multiple deficiencies (5 and 6) including unsecured resident records, incomplete medication documentation, missing DNR orders, and unsecured cleaning supplies.
- Complaint investigations in 2023 substantiated failures in staffing on the secured unit and foul odors in resident rooms, indicating ongoing issues with resident care and building maintenance.
